Basic information Supplier
Neuropeptide Y (13-36), human, rat, [Leu31,Pro34]- Structure

Neuropeptide Y (13-36), human, rat, [Leu31,Pro34]-

Preparation Products And Raw materials

Neuropeptide Y (13-36), human, rat, [Leu31,Pro34]- Suppliers